The Origins of “Let Him Cook”
The phrase “Let him cook” is often attributed to the world of basketball, but its roots can be traced back to the culinary world. In cooking, “let it cook” is a common instruction that means allowing a dish to simmer or cook for a period of time without interference. This phrase is often used to advise cooks to resist the temptation to stir or intervene too much, as this can disrupt the cooking process and affect the final result.
In basketball, the phrase “Let him cook” is thought to have originated in the early 2000s, when coaches and commentators began using it to describe a player who was on a hot streak or in a zone. The idea was that when a player was “cooking,” they were in a state of flow, where their skills and instincts took over, and they were able to perform at an exceptionally high level.

What is the meaning of “Let Him Cook” in basketball?
“Let Him Cook” is a phrase that originated in basketball to describe a player who is on a hot streak, making shots and playing exceptionally well. It is often used to encourage the player to continue playing without interference or to give them the freedom to make their own decisions on the court. The phrase is usually directed at the player’s teammates or coaches, urging them to let the player continue their momentum without disrupting their flow.
The phrase has become a popular way to acknowledge a player’s exceptional performance and to give them the confidence to keep playing at a high level. It is often used in conjunction with other phrases, such as “he’s on fire” or “he’s in the zone,” to emphasize the player’s exceptional play. By using the phrase “Let Him Cook,” fans, teammates, and coaches can show their appreciation for the player’s skills and encourage them to continue performing at their best.
